The course will include 2-3 meetings, where the lecturer will give the advices on how to conduct a heuristic evaluation and a usability study. You need to attend these meetings. You will be assigned to do 8 small homeworks and also study some topics yourself (material will be provided by the teacher).

The meetings and homeworks will happen during January and February. The biggest part of the course will be the project work done in groups. In the project work, you conduct a heuristic evaluation, plan, pilot  and eventually run, analyze and report the usability study. An advisor will guide your group during the project work. The project work starts in January and ends in May.
